ECommerce is disrupting the Alcohol Beverage industry – while the move to eCommerce has accelerated during COVID-19, this trend is here to stay. No one has been able to “crack the code” on eCommerce within the industry, so we are excited to co-discuss this topic among the panelists and explore some of the latest trends, data & insights.

Deloitte Consulting will share a quick overview of the current Alcohol Beverage eCommerce landscape and then moderate a panel with Corporate Members, Drizly, RNDC, and Treasury Wine Estates who have each made unique and significant strides in this space. Panelists will be sharing how their companies have pivoted with the acceleration of eCommerce during COVID, found new routes to reach customers, and used data to understand their customers at a deeper level than ever before.

Liz Paquette is a strategic marketer and planner, with over a decade of experience in advertising and the startup world. At Drizly, North America's largest ecommerce marketplace for alcohol, Liz heads up brand and consumer insights. In her role, she leads brand strategy and marketing, communications, content and creative, and the data and insights publication, BevAlc Insights. Prior to Drizly, Liz led marketing and was part of the founding team at HUBweek, an innovation festival and civic initiative founded by The Boston Globe, Harvard, MIT, and Massachusetts General Hospital. She started her career in travel planning and advertising and is WSET Level 3 certified.

Renee is currently SVP of Digital Transformation and Business Engagement at RNDC (Republic National Distributing Company).  RNDC is an industry leader and the nation’s second largest wine and spirits distributor.  In her role Renee leads multiple IT teams covering eCommerce, Commercial Systems, Data & Analytics, Enterprise Architecture and emerging technology.  She is also a program leader for their current ERP Modernization multi-year effort.

 

Prior to RNDC, Renee was Head of Business Integration for Georgia Pacific’s largest digital transformation program to date - CPG Digital Core.  She was responsible for leading business integration and organizational change management for GP’s Consumer Products business to implement SAP S4/HANA and associated end-to-end business process across corporate sites, consumer manufacturing facilities, and distribution centers.

 

Renee also spent nearly 20 years in multiple leadership roles at Kimberly-Clark (K-C), a global Consumer Products company recognized by its strong brands such as Huggies, Kleenex, and Kotex.  She led business and technology teams through innovation and digital transformation activities leveraging emerging technology.  Renee also spent several years within K-C IT Strategy during the successful divesture of K-C’s Health Care business, Halyard Health, and spent over a decade leading and advancing K-C’s IT data and analytics strategy and delivery.

 

Renee holds a degree in Management Information Systems from the University of Wisconsin - Eau Claire. She is actively engaged in the Atlanta professional community through various board engagements and is also an advocate for programs such as Girl Scouts of America and promoting diversity and women in technology. She currently resides with her family in Roswell, GA.

Katie is a Principal with Monitor Deloitte, Deloitte Consulting's Strategy Practice. She works with her clients to transform their businesses, achieving accelerated growth through the identification and implementation of new and differentiated ways to understand and engage their consumers.

Katie has led consumer-focused growth programs for some of the world's largest brands, including growth strategy, digital transformation, marketing capability development, and digital commerce acceleration. She has extensive experience working in the alcohol beverage space across wine, spirits and beer in her current role -- and spent nearly ten years working in the restaurant industry prior to joining Deloitte. Katie is passionate about developing strong, diverse teams and mentorship. She received her BS from Cornell and her MBA from UCLA.

Specialties include: growth strategy, marketing strategy & capability building, digital strategy & transformation, channel & customer strategy, digital commerce & direct-to-consumer strategy
